Intense School Co-Founder Barry Kaufman to Head Up Fast Lane's Cyber Security Business
New Training Portfolio to Include High-End Cyber Security Courses and Certification Boot Camps
CARY, NC April 16, 2010 /Security PR News/ -- Fast Lane (www.fastlaneus.com), a leading worldwide provider of advanced IT training, has announced that it now offers high-end information security training and certification courses leveraging the experience and expertise of the core staff from the former Intense School. Intense School Co-Founder Barry Kaufman, CISSP, MCSE, CEH, ITILv3, will head up course development, business development and subject matter expert management for Fast Lane's new Cyber Security and Certification Boot Camp lines of business.
"Intense School was very well known for its Boot Camps and high-end security training," said Chuck Terrien, president of Fast Lane Americas. "This is an exciting opportunity for us to bring the same high-quality training that Intense School was known for to our customers."
Fast Lane is pleased to offer new information security classes and comprehensive Certification Boot Camps, including:
-- (ISC)2 CISSP , ISSEP, SSCP and CAP Boot Camps
-- ISACA CISA and CISM Boot Camps
-- Cisco CCNA, CCNP, CCSP and CCVP Boot Camps
-- CompTIA Security+, Network+ and A+ Boot Camps
-- EC-Council CHFI (Forensics), CEH (Hacking) and ECSA/LPT Boot Camps
-- Application Security Seminars and Skills Development Programs (.NET, Java/J2EE, Web Services)
-- Database Security Programs (Oracle, SQL and DB2)
-- Security Awareness Programs
-- DISA STIGs training
-- DIACAP training
In addition to new offerings in InfoSec and Certification Boot Camps, Fast Lane has developed new programs for ITIL and Project Management. Fast Lane will continue to leverage its excellent vendor relationships with NetApp, Cisco, VMware, IBM and Ubuntu to develop unique multi-vendor security training.

Kaufman has over 18 years of IT and telecommunications experience, including over 12 years leading IT/InfoSec training businesses. He custom-developed Information Assurance Workforce training programs in support of the DoD 8570.1 Directive and is an original and continuing Cornerstone Member for the CompTIA Security+ Certification. Kaufman has led the design, development and delivery of programs focused on the training and certification of over 30,000 IT and InfoSec professionals in the federal government. About Fast Lane
Fast Lane, founded in 1996, began its U.S. operations in 2005. Through its partnerships with top vendors such as Cisco, NetApp, IBM, VMware and Ubuntu, the company delivers advanced technology and professional skills training. Fast Lane also provides businesses with customized-content training solutions built around their unique demands through corporate on-site, classroom and Instructor-Led Online (ILO) training sessions. In 2009, Fast Lane was named by TrainingIndustry.com as one of the Top 20 IT Training Companies for the second year in a row.
